## Environment Variables: Zero-Downtime Migrations

The Pellwright migrator runs expand/contract phases against the replica first, gating each contract step on lag metrics. Reviewers should confirm MIGRATE_PHASE and LAG_THRESHOLD_MS match the rollout ticket before merge. The migrator authenticates to the coordination lock service using the credential defined on the next line of the env file.

vault entry, yahaf-tagug: LEDGER_TOKEN20=884d77d1a8b98aa4edfb

The Orvane Labs bike cage and the east and west parking gates operate on separate access schedules, and facilities desk staff should note that visitor vehicles may only use the west gate between 07:00 and 19:00. Cyclists requesting cage access must show a valid day pass, and their details should be entered in the access ledger before the cage is opened. Gates must never be propped open, even briefly, during deliveries. When a manual override is required at either gate, use the code below.

staff pass of fadup-fawig = bdg-FUNKS-4

## Step 4: Migrate the Undo/Redo Stack

Sketchloom 3 replaces the in-memory undo history with a persisted action log, so redo survives editor reloads. Run the `history-migrate` task before upgrading any workspace on the Varnwell tenant. The task rewrites legacy snapshots into the new delta format; diagrams with more than 500 undo entries are truncated to the most recent 200. The migration tool reads its target from the connection below.

replica DSN, kajep-yahag: mssql://praok_svc:iF@db-8d68.plorvaio.local:5432/eliion